"U.Lucchetta Construction Limited is working to identify ways to provide an overall benefit to American Chestnut. These may involve: planting, monitoring and tending to five American Chestnut seedlings;
supporting research that will contribute to the genetic conservation and recovery of American Chestnuts in Ontario, specifically those that demonstrate a tolerance to Chestnut Blight."

This is not a plan. Saying that they are "working to identify ways" to provide an overall benefit does not provide enough detail to evaluate whether or not this project will indeed provide an overall benefit. Furthermore, no evidence is provided to support the notion that the potential activities they suggest (planting saplings, contributing to research) will be effective in providing an overall benefit.

What is the survival rate for American Chestnut seedlings? How susceptible are younger trees to Blight as compared to adult trees? These questions are unanswered.

Additionally, the fact that these American Chestnut trees are still living might be a sign that one or all of them are blight resistant, which the replacement seedlings may not be.

Overall, these actions are incomplete, vague, and do not support the idea that there will be an overall benefit to this species as a result of the project. The permit should not be approved.
